A transient was jailed by the Douglas County Sheriff’s Office for warrants after being contacted on Friday.
A DCSO report said at 8:00 a.m. a deputy observed two vehicles parked near the intersection of Rolling Hills Road and Austin Road in Green. The deputy noticed that two subjects were sleeping in one of the vehicles. The man allegedly immediately put a jacket over his face when the deputy made contact.
The female transient was cooperative and provided her information. Other deputies were able to help identify the man. Dispatchers said he had a felony parole board warrant and a warrant out of Roseburg. The transient was cooperative and was taken into custody without incident.
He was detained for the warrants and was held on $10,000 bail.
